7. Meanwhile, way south of the border...
All the way down in Chile, in fact, where abortions are illegal no matter what the circumstances of the pregnancy or the threat to the health of the mother, an 11-year-old rape victim called Belen has no choice but to carry the baby to term. When Belen, who has been raped by her stepfather for two years, told a local news station that having the baby “will be like having a doll in her arms,” Chilean president Sebastian Pinera praised her for the “depth and maturity” of her “choice.”
Comparing a baby and a doll sounds mature to us.
Another genius politician in Chile, Issa Kort, a member of parliament, showed an Akin-like sophistication in his understanding of reproduction when he said Belen must be ready to have a child because she can menstruate. Circular logic to be sure.
